Analysis

In 2019, getting credit: strength of legal rights index (0-12) in Vanuatu stood at 11 DB15-20 methodology. That is the highest value across all 7 years on record.

The figure is up 10.0% over ten years.

Vanuatu ranks 6th of 191 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The strength of legal rights index measures whether certain features that facilitate lending exist within the appli­cable collateral and bankruptcy laws. The index ranges from 0 to 12 based on the methodology in the DB15-20 studies.
